Loan impossible to settle

About 5 years ago I took out a loan of about R50 000 which I paid R2400 per month. At one stage about 2 and a half years ago my husband was retrenched and I couldn’t make a payment for a few months. African Bank then came to see me to make an arrangement whereby I pay only R1200 every month. I understood that meant that I will pay off the loan over a longer period than initially agreed. However, it’s 2 and a half years later and I have not skipped a payment but when I requested a settlement quote in Feb 2018 it showed that I owed African Bank R42000. When I requested a settlement quote again on 22 June 2019 it’s now reflecting that I owe African Bank R51000? How is this possible?? I do understand that my loan will take longer to pay off due to me only paying half of the original agreed amount. However, what I don’t understand is my settlement that just keeps increasing even though I make a payment every month. So this means that I will never be able to settle my African Bank loan. It feels like I am being ****** because the more I pay the more I owe.

I did go into a African Bank branch in Midrand on 22 June 2019 and the consultant was not able to assist me. He only printed out my statement for the last 2 years where it shows that my settlement amount is just increasing.
